Human EDNRB Full Length Protein (VLP)
Human EDNRB Full Length Protein (VLP)

Human EDNRB Full Length Protein (VLP)

1109.87

1109.87
In Stock
quantity
product details

Catalog number: 716 - EDB-H52P7

Product Category: Business & Industrial > Science & Laboratory

Supplier:

ACROBIOSYSTEMSGentaur

Size: 500ug